This novel weaves the story of a young woman navigating her path through the challenges posed by her family's legacy and the landscape that shapes her journey.
Set against the backdrop of the American West, the book delves into themes of belonging and the indelible impact of nature on our lives. Readers will find themselves immersed in the rich descriptions of the land, which serve as both a character and a canvas for the protagonist's struggles and triumphs. The lyrical prose captures the essence of the river that runs through the narrative, symbolizing the flow of life and the inevitability of change.
